Frequently Asked Questions about Pinyon Pines

How much are Studio apartments in Pinyon Pines?

There are currently 12 Studio Apartments in Pinyon Pines with rent ranges from $1,479 to $2,160 with an average price of $1,617.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Pinyon Pines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Pinyon Pines ranges from $1,262 to $2,870 with an average monthly rent of $1,853.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Pinyon Pines c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Pinyon Pines range from $1,781 to $3,335.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,417.

How expensive are Pinyon Pines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 14 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Pinyon Pines on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,386 to $4,305 - averaging $3,441 for the location.
